Списки

Набор блоков, позволяющих работать со списками. Список - это набор переменных любого типа.

../../../_images/image_120.png

Создание списков

Создайте переменную для хранения списка.

Создание пустого списка

../../../_images/image_216.png

Создание списка из элементов

../../../_images/image_38.png

Вы можете редактировать количество элементов в данном блоке.

../../../_images/gif_11.gif

Создание списка из одинаковых элементов

../../../_images/image_47.png

Операции со списками

#1 - первый элемент.

Получить элемент списка

Возвращает элемент с указанной позиции списка.

../../../_images/image_93.png

Удалить элемент списка

Удаляет элемент в указанной позиции списка.

../../../_images/image_101.png

Присвоить значение элементу списка

Присваивает значение элементу в указанной позиции списка.

../../../_images/image_1110.png

Вставить элемент списка

Вставляет элемент в указанную позицию списка.

../../../_images/image_121.png

Получить длину списка

../../../_images/image_54.png

Проверка, пуст ли список

Возвращает «истину» или «ложь», поэтому используется с логическими блоками.

../../../_images/image_63.png

Найти элемент

Возвращает номер позиции первого/последнего вхождения элемента в списке. Возвращает 0, если элемент не найден.

../../../_images/image_73.png

Взять подсписок

Возвращает копию указанной части спика.

../../../_images/image_83.png